King Gilgamesh: The Legendary Warrior-King of Uruk King Gilgamesh is one of the most iconic figures in ancient history and mythology, best known as the central character in the Epic of Gilgamesh, one of the oldest surviving works of literature. His tale, filled with adventure, existential questions, and profound lessons about life and death, has captivated generations for thousands of years. But who exactly was Gilgamesh, and what is the legacy of his story? Who Was King Gilgamesh? Gilgamesh is believed to have been a real king who ruled the ancient Sumerian city of Uruk, located in modern-day Iraq, around 2700-2500 BCE. While the exact historical details of his reign remain debated, his existence is often corroborated by Sumerian texts and archaeological findings. Gilgamesh's legendary status, however, largely comes from the Epic of Gilgamesh, a Mesopotamian poem that paints him as a semi-divine hero — two-thirds god and one-third human. This unique heritage played a significant role in shaping his character as a powerful and often impulsive ruler. The Epic of Gilgamesh: A Tale of Heroism, Mortality, and Friendship The Epic of Gilgamesh chronicles the adventures of Gilgamesh as he seeks to conquer death, achieve eternal fame, and understand the meaning of life. His journey is shaped by his complex relationship with his people, his overwhelming arrogance, and his profound existential quest. 1. Gilgamesh's Rule: A Hero with a Flaw In the early stages of the epic, Gilgamesh is portrayed as a powerful yet oppressive king. Though he is credited with building the walls of Uruk, symbolizing his might, he also exerts tyranny over his subjects. His arrogance and unchallenged rule alienate the people of Uruk, leading the gods to create a counterpart: Enkidu. 2. Enkidu: The Wild Companion Enkidu, created by the gods to humble Gilgamesh, begins as a wild man, living among animals in the wilderness. When Enkidu meets Gilgamesh, the two engage in a battle that ultimately leads to a deep friendship. This bond transforms both men. Enkidu teaches Gilgamesh the value of companionship and humility, and together, they embark on epic quests, including the defeat of the monstrous Humbaba and the slaying of the Bull of Heaven sent by the goddess Ishtar. 3. The Quest for Immortality The most defining feature of Gilgamesh’s journey is his quest for immortality. When Enkidu dies after the gods punish him for the duo's defiance, Gilgamesh is struck by the harsh reality of human mortality. Devastated by his friend's death, Gilgamesh sets out to find Utnapishtim, a sage who survived a great flood and was granted eternal life by the gods. Throughout his journey, Gilgamesh grapples with the impermanence of life and the inevitability of death. Despite his best efforts, he ultimately learns that immortality is unattainable for humans, and that wisdom lies in accepting death as a natural part of existence. Key Themes of the Epic The Epic of Gilgamesh explores timeless themes that resonate with readers to this day: Mortality: The epic's most profound lesson is the inevitability of death. Gilgamesh’s journey reflects the universal human struggle to come to terms with mortality. Friendship: The bond between Gilgamesh and Enkidu is central to the narrative, showing how friendship can provide strength, solace, and meaning in life. Leadership: Gilgamesh’s growth from a self-centered ruler to a wiser, more compassionate leader highlights the transformative power of personal development and self-reflection. The Search for Meaning: Gilgamesh's quest for immortality symbolizes humanity's broader quest for meaning and purpose in life. Gilgamesh’s Legacy Despite his flaws, Gilgamesh's journey is one of profound personal growth and discovery. His story remains a cornerstone of world literature, influencing countless works in mythology, literature, and even modern pop culture. His legacy is not just as a king or a hero, but as a figure who embodies the human struggle to understand life, death, and what lies beyond. The Epic of Gilgamesh continues to be studied and adapted in various forms, from literature and film to art and philosophy, ensuring that the king of Uruk remains a lasting figure in human storytelling.

The iconic manga "BLEACH" comes from Japan and is written by talented Tite Kubo. Serialized in Shueisha's Weekly Shônen Jump, there it first appeared 4 unforgettable characters along with a fantastic story. At its core is the tale of high school student Ichigo Kurosaki and his transformation into a Soul Reaper.
